Job Opportunity:

This exciting role offers a unique blend of quality and regulatory affairs responsibilities, providing an exceptional opportunity for professional growth and development.

The successful candidate will be responsible for managing key quality systems, including change controls, deviations, complaints, and CAPAs, while supporting regulatory activities across a diverse product portfolio.

Working closely with cross-functional teams and external partners, you will play a central role in maintaining compliance and ensuring timely approvals and documentation.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Act as the liaison between customers and corporate quality functions
  • Manage change controls, deviations, complaints, and CAPAs
  • Support product quality reviews and GMP compliance activities
  • Prepare and submit regulatory variations and notifications to authorities
  • Provide guidance on labelling and regulatory documentation for submissions
  • Assist with packaging and artwork issue resolution
  • Coordinate cross-functional collaboration with R&D, Supply, and Business Development
  • Identify and support quality system improvements and handle technical queries

Requirements:

  • Tertiary qualification in Science, Pharmacy, or related discipline
  • 3-4 years of experience in pharmaceutical Quality Assurance or Regulatory Affairs
  • Strong understanding of GMP, TGA, and Medsafe regulatory frameworks
  • Exceptional attention to detail and organisational skills
  • Strong stakeholder communication and project coordination abilities
  • Self-motivated, adaptable, and proactive in driving process improvement
